Theresa, question for you:

the autometer console guage harness you sell, does that plug right into the factory harness?

I have an auto console non guage setup now, going to manual console autometer setup.

Thanks

AAW
08-17-2006, 07:09 AM
Rob,
It is not a direct plug-in as the original dash harness does not include extensions for the sensor leads for the gauges. The kit has the wires that you will need, but because the dash does not have the extended wires, you'll have to add them which makes it NOT a direct plugin.

Also, the autometer use a voltmeter. The original console gauges used an ammeter. Changes in the console gauge wiring itself would be done by us to acommodate the voltmeter. The extensions you will need are for temp gauge, fuel gauge, and oil pressure gauge.

Hope this helps.
